The Church of Saint Anne is thought to be the oldest church in Trabzon city, Turkey, dating to the 6th or 7th century. It has not seen service in over a century, but has recently (2021-22) been thoroughly restored. With whitewash removed, all remaining frescos have now become visible. The church is accessible to the public free of charge during daytime hours.
